Edwin Díaz Blows First Save Since 2022, Mets Swept By Rays

Following losses in the initial two games of the series, the New York Mets (16-18) aimed to clinch victory in the Sunday afternoon finale against the Tampa Bay Rays. While the offense managed to score when necessary, it fell short as the bullpen faltered in the late stages, resulting in a 7-6 defeat and a sweep by the Tampa Bay Rays. Blade Tidwell, Nolan McLean Dominate On The Mound

The starting pitching in Binghamton (Double-A) and Brooklyn (High-A) impressed on Saturday. Blade Tidwell threw eight scoreless innings with nine strikeouts while Nolan McLean went five scoreless innings with nine strikeouts. Brett Baty Connected For Two Homers in Loss on Friday

Brett Baty showed just why he belongs in the majors on Friday night by displaying his power at Tropicana Field. The third baseman went 3-for-4, blasting two home runs, driving in four RBIs, and scoring two runs in the Mets’ 10-8 loss to Tampa Bay in what was also Baty’s first career multi-home run game.
